The Clinical Lead is responsible for ensuring the safe, effective, and high-quality delivery of clinical care across all homecare and supported living services. This role oversees clinical governance, supports risk management, ensures compliance with CQC standards, and provides expert clinical leadership to staff delivering care to adults and/or children with complex needs. The Clinical Lead will champion best practice, lead on competency assessments, oversee care planning, and act as the clinical point of escalation for service users, families, commissioners, and multidisciplinary teams.

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ide clinical leadership and oversight across homecare packages and supported living services.
  • Ensure safe, competent delivery of complex clinical care and interventions.
  • Complete clinical assessments and contribute to reviews and complex care planning.
  • Lead clinical triage, incident investigation, risk escalation, and safeguarding responses.
  • Develop, review, and quality-assure person-centred care plans and clinical risk assessments.
  • Ensure compliance with CQC standards, clinical governance, and organisational policies.
  • Oversee audits, medication management, infection control, and clinical documentation.
  • Deliver clinical training, assess competencies, and provide supervision to staff.
  • Act as clinical liaison with MDTs, commissioners, families, and external professionals.
  • Support service development, including new package mobilisation and quality improvement initiatives.

Qualifications

  • Registered Nurse (RGN/RMN/RNLD) with active NMC registration essential.
  • Clinical supervision or mentorship qualification desirable.
  • Additional specialist clinical training (e.g., tracheostomy, ventilation, PEG, epilepsy) is an advantage.

Experience

  • Minimum 3 years post-registration experience.
  • Experience in homecare, community nursing, supported living, or complex care essential.
  • Experience supervising staff and managing clinical risk.
  • Confidence leading on safeguarding, clinical governance, and quality assurance.
